How to Negotiate a Car Accident Settlement

If you've been injured in an accident in the car you could be entitled to an settlement. However, the amount of compensation you receive will be contingent on numerous aspects.

When determining the value of your claim for car accident You should take into consideration the cost of medical expenses damages to property, medical expenses, and loss of income. A personal injury lawyer can help you get the most effective results from your settlement.

How it works

Settlements for car accident victims are a great way of recovering damages for your injuries or losses. However, they can be complicated and require lots of legal expertise and attention. It is important to locate a knowledgeable personal injury lawyer to assist you in obtaining the most fair settlement.

Your lawyer will help determine the amount of compensation you are entitled to for your damages. They will collect medical records, witness' statements, photographs and video of the crash as well as other pertinent information to help strengthen your case.

They will also determine the cost of your injuries. This includes the loss of earnings, future and current medical expenses, as well as other costs associated with the accident.

After calculating your damages your attorney will begin negotiating with the insurance company on your behalf. The goal of a successful settlement is to compensate you the maximum amount of money for your losses, without having to bring a lawsuit or wait for an appeal.

Your lawyer will negotiate a fair settlement with the insurance company. As part of your claim they will retain a portion of any settlement amount as an expense.

After the settlement has been accepted, you can receive the agreed-upon amount within 30 days. If you have a child in your vehicle you can also be included in the settlement if they suffered injuries as a result of the crash.

To determine the amount you should settle the insurance company will employ the formula. It takes into account economic damages as well as a multiplier that is built on hundreds of thousands of cases from the past.

This multiplier is designed to predict the amount that a jury might be willing to award you, if you start a lawsuit and take your case to trial. It's not an exact predictor, but it can provide you with an idea of how much your case is worth.

In addition, your settlement may include a payment to medical providers who treated you for your injuries. If you do not receive reimbursement from your insurance for the treatment they provided, this payment can be reduced.

Insurance Claims

Insurance companies offer compensation to victims of car accidents. They can be filed with the insurance company of the at-fault driver or with their own insurer. The procedure for filing a claim varies based on the laws of your state as well as the policy language used.

It is important to keep a thorough account of all expenses prior to the time you file an insurance claim. This includes medical expenses as well as lost earnings and property damage. It is also a good idea to to obtain a copy of the police report. This will help to document any injuries and serve as evidence when settling the claim.

Once you have all the details, contact your insurance company and make your claim as quickly as possible. It is best not to wait until the last minute to file your claim.

After you have submitted your initial insurance claim An adjuster will be appointed to investigate the accident. They will review your insurance policy and other records, speak to witnesses, assess the damage to your vehicle, and much more.

They will try to determine who is at fault for the accident and what coverage each party has. They will then use this information to decide whether or not to accept your claim.

If they accept your claim, you can then discuss with the insurance company over the amount of settlement. This usually happens through mediation in which a neutral third party will sit down with you and insurance company's representatives.

This is essential since it will ensure you receive the most money you can for your injuries and damages. However, car accident attorney it's not always straightforward.

It is best to employ an experienced personal injury lawyer who can negotiate with the insurance company on your behalf. This lawyer will help you gather as much evidence as possible and help you build your case to win the settlement that you deserve.

Negotiating

A settlement in a car accident attorney accident can be a means of getting compensation for injuries sustained in an accident. Negotiating with insurance companies can be a challenge.

In order to get a good settlement, you'll need strong evidence. This includes medical records, witness statements and any other pertinent information. It's important to have an attorney to represent you.

An experienced attorney can help you construct your case and gather the evidence you need to support your claims. They can also negotiate with the insurance company to improve your chances of a better settlement.

Before you meet with an insurance adjuster, you must decide what the minimum amount you're willing to accept as compensation. This should be a reasonable amount that covers all of your expenses including treatment and lost wages.

During negotiations, you'll have to be direct and clear about your requirements. Create a list of things you cannot compromise and those you are able to compromise. It's not a surprise by an insurance company offering you something that you don't like.

It's also important to remember that insurance companies aren't in your corner. They're just trying to defend themselves, and they'll seek every opportunity to avoid paying you money.

A professional lawyer with a proven track record of success is a good choice to reduce the risk of being taken advantage by the insurance company. A competent personal injury lawyer can assist you in constructing your case, gather the necessary evidence and assist you during negotiations.

An experienced accident lawyer can present compelling evidence for you which can assist you in obtaining a higher settlement than you'd receive on your own. This may include providing thorough details of your injuries and how they've affected your daily life.

After you've collected all the evidence you require now is the time to begin the negotiation process. The process usually begins with a demand note to the insurance company. This letter should describe the circumstances of the accident, your injuries as well as your losses.

Filing a Lawsuit

A car accident lawsuit might be necessary if you have been seriously injured in an automobile accident. The lawsuit gives you the legal right to hold the responsible parties accountable for the harm they did to you, which includes the cost of medical expenses, lost wages, and property damage.

The lawsuit must be filed in a court, usually within the state in which the accident occurred. You should also be familiar with the statutes of limitations of your state. These laws limit the length of time you can file a suit, so it is important that you seek legal advice as soon as possible after an accident occurs.

In the state where you reside It is possible to have anywhere from three to six years after the accident to file a lawsuit. This is called the statute of limitations. It is intended to stop people from trying to sue too late.

Even if you have the legal right to file a lawsuit, you should be prepared for a lengthy process that could consume the majority of your time and energy. This includes waiting for your insurance company to review your case, and for your attorney and for the court's decision.

It can take time to gather all evidence and proof to support your case. To build your case and argue it in court, you'll need to collect the police report, witness statements, and other crucial information.

In addition to the time, a lawsuit can incur substantial costs, both in terms of filing fees and other costs. If the case is going to trial, these costs can reach $10,000. It is also more expensive to hire an attorney to represent your case in the courtroom.

You must have a clear understanding of how much your car accident claim is worth prior to you begin negotiations. This will help you make an informed choice about whether to settle your case in court or to go to court.
